The popular shopping building, Tenjin Core, closes its doors today, March 31. The fashion center opened 44 years ago with the concept of bringing the trends and fashions of Tokyo’s Shinjuku & Harajuku to Fukuoka. Despite fewer shoppers in the area due to the new coronavirus, the shopping center attracted many fans for a final closing sale. To avoid crowds, the closing ceremony will be live-streamed on YouTube (3/31 21:30~ *may be delayed, Youtube) and without an onsite audience. Source: Asahi 2020-03-31
